Queen Creek buys Barney Family Sports Complex

By Janet Perez | Queen Creek Independent

Queen Creek officials have announced the recent purchase of the Barney Family Sports Complex for use as a future public safety facility.

The nearly 65,000-square foot facility is at 22050 E. Queen Creek Road on 10 acres. Current operations may continue at the facility through summer 2023.

“Public safety continues to be one of the town’s top priorities,” stated Queen Creek Mayor Julia Wheatley, in a press release. “The town has been evaluating options for a public safety complex to meet the needs of the police department and the fire and medical department. The purchase of the Barney Family Sports Complex not only meets the functional needs of the public safety facility, but the location is ideal, and the cost is less than purchasing land and building a new facility.”
